Boopa's Bagel Deli

6513 N. Beach St., Fort Worth TX

(817) 232-4771

Email Boopa's Bagel Deli

Hours of Operation Today,
  • LIKELY OPEN

Rated 4.5 out of 5 from 2 Reviews
Location